Ruck noun

\ˈrək\

Other forms of word:

-rucked (v.)-rucking (v.)-rucks (v.)Def: A tightly packed crowd of people.-Her personality made her be able to be distinguished from the ruck.Way to Remember: ruck is in the word ruckus which could be seen as a disturbance in the crowd.Slide3

Anachronism noun

\ə-ˈna-krə-ˌni-zəm\

Other Forms of Word:

-anachronistic (adj.)-anachronistically (adv.)Def: event out of place in time -Many of his views were not of the modern generation, and he was seen as an anachronism.Way to Remember: A chronometer is a clock- anachronismSlide4

Eke adverb

\ˈēk\

Other Forms of Word:

-eked (trans. v.)-eking (trans. v.)Def: to support oneself/make a living with difficulty-In this economy many people just eke through every day.Way to Remember: When someone asks you how you are getting through respond with “eeeeeeekee”Slide5

Quail verb

\ˈkwāl\

Other Forms of Word:

-quailed (intr. v.)-quailing (intr. v.)-quails (intr. v.)Def: show fear or apprehension-All of the other competitors quail before approaching her.Way to Remember: when you quail you tend to wail out in fear.Slide6

Tryst noun

\ˈtrist\

Other Forms of Word:

-trysted (intr. v.)-trysting (intr. v.)-trysts (intr. v.)Def: private romantic rendezvous between lovers-They had to be sure that nobody found out about the tryst planned at midnight.Way to Remember: when you have a tryst you try to keep it a secret
